Agriculture
and environmental sectors are undergoing a digital shift, embracing precision
farming and real-time ecosystem monitoring. NB‑IoT enables cost-effective deployment of large-scale sensor networks
measuring soil moisture, nutrient levels, weather conditions, and crop health.
Its long battery life and deep rural coverage make it ideal for farms, forests,
and remote environmental monitoring stations. Farmers can automate irrigation,
apply fertilizers based on real data, and detect anomalies—like pest
infestations—early on. As of 2024, an estimated 25 million sensors for
agriculture and environmental monitoring had been deployed across Asia and
Europe using NB IoT. These sensors enabled farmers to make data-driven
decisions for irrigation and fertilization while helping governments track air
and water quality. NB IoT’s robust coverage allowed devices to function
reliably in rural and remote environments.
Environmental
agencies and NGOs also benefit from NB‑IoT’s
capabilities. Sensors monitoring air quality, water levels, or wildlife
presence can be deployed in inaccessible areas and remain operational for
years. Governments can use this data to inform disaster response,
policy-making, and ecological conservation efforts. NB‑IoT’s affordability enables massive sensor
deployment, facilitating granular environmental intelligence previously
restricted by cost or connectivity limitations.
Government
investments in smart city programs are rapidly driving the adoption of NB-IoT
enterprise applications, particularly in traffic management, environmental
monitoring, waste collection, and public safety systems. Municipalities favor
NB-IoT because it offers low deployment and operational costs, long device
lifespans, and wide-area network coverage, even in underground or densely
constructed areas. Devices such as smart parking sensors, air quality monitors,
and connected street lighting are being widely deployed across urban centers,
many under public-private partnership models.
Several
countries, including China, South Korea, Germany, and the United Arab Emirates,
are actively embedding NB-IoT infrastructure in public systems. These
deployments enable local governments to gather critical real-time data, enhance
city services, and improve sustainability metrics such as energy efficiency and
carbon emissions. This trend is expected to gain momentum, especially as global
urban populations continue to rise and infrastructure modernization becomes a
political and economic priority. For technology providers and system
integrators, public sector partnerships are emerging as a high-potential
channel for long-term enterprise growth.

In
2024, the IT and Telecom segment emerged as the fastest-growing end user
segment within the Global Narrowband IoT (NB-IoT) Enterprise Application
Market, driven by the increasing demand for reliable, low-power connectivity
solutions to support expanding networks of smart devices and services.
Telecommunications providers, in particular, have played a pivotal role by
deploying nationwide NB-IoT infrastructure to enhance coverage, especially in
hard-to-reach or remote areas. These networks support a growing portfolio of
enterprise solutions, including smart grid management, predictive maintenance,
and remote asset monitoring, making them integral to the digital transformation
strategies of telecom operators.
The
IT industry has also embraced NB-IoT to enable seamless data collection,
automation, and remote control across a broad array of IoT devices. The rise of
cloud computing, edge computing, and 5G integration has created synergies with
NB-IoT, allowing IT enterprises to deliver highly efficient, scalable, and
secure solutions for various industrial applications. Additionally, the shift
toward service-based business models has led IT and telecom companies to invest
in IoT-enabled platforms and managed services. As data-driven operations become
essential for enterprise competitiveness, the IT and Telecom segment is
expected to sustain its growth trajectory in the NB-IoT ecosystem.
In
2024, the Asia Pacific region emerged as the fastest-growing market in the
Global Narrowband IoT (NB-IoT) Enterprise Application Market, fueled by robust
government initiatives, rapid urbanization, and expanding industrial
automation. Countries such as China, India, South Korea, and Japan made
significant investments in smart city infrastructure, energy efficiency
programs, and agriculture digitization, all of which leverage NB-IoT technology
for real-time data transmission and low-power device connectivity. The presence
of major telecom operators and equipment manufacturers accelerated NB-IoT
network rollouts across both urban and rural areas. Additionally, supportive
policy frameworks and rising enterprise demand for cost-effective IoT
connectivity solutions have positioned Asia Pacific as a critical driver of
innovation and adoption in the global NB-IoT enterprise landscape.
